Output 38f7186e1a7ff46caba9f59cd1376079f6ad9ad52182a092465147c0e7206e2a:0

value
115204
script pubkey
OP_0 OP_PUSHBYTES_20 23c63bab5861cee2f6779bb336ad35c9455f55f7
address
bc1qy0rrh26cv88w9anhnwendtf4e9z4740hsz6xnr
transaction
38f7186e1a7ff46caba9f59cd1376079f6ad9ad52182a092465147c0e7206e2a
confirmations
244436
spent
true